Insights on the Healthcare Trajectories of People Living With Dementia.
People living with dementia follow different healthcare trajectories based on the individual healthcare needs and external supports available to them. We explored healthcare trajectories involving home care and long-term care settings, associated factors and hospitalizations prior to transitioning to these settings. This study was part of a collaborative project between the Canadian Institute for Health Information and the Public Health Agency of Canada that supported the implementation of the national dementia strategy (PHAC 2019) through the Enhanced Dementia Surveillance Initiative (Government of Canada 2023). This initiative aimed to inform public health actions with new findings from surveillance and data.
